When preparation of Z-VAD-FMK DMSO solution, Should I use standard grade or Sterile, Anhydrous DMSO for stock solutions?
It is highly recommended to use Cell Culture Grade, Anhydrous DMSO
- Why Anhydrous? The FMK (fluoromethyl ketone) group is susceptible to hydrolysis over time. Using anhydrous DMSO minimizes moisture-induced degradation, extending the shelf life of your stock.
- Why Sterile? Since Z-VAD-FMK is often used in long-term cell culture assays, starting with a sterile solvent prevents contamination risks. If you use non-sterile DMSO, you may need to filter the final working solution, which introduces potential loss of the compound.
